Ger Lyons’ smart Juddmonte-filly Faiyum makes her seasonal reappearance today, with testing ground in her favour for the Curragh’s Group 3 Irish Stallion Farms EBF Park Express Stakes.

Successful in three of four career starts all last year, Faiyum routed her rivals to win Gowran’s Group 3 Denny Cordell Lanwades Stud Stakes on heavy ground last September.

The four-year-old faces nine rivals, including Aidan O’Brien’s Classic-entered Moments Of Joy, with trainer Lyons’ brother and assistant trainer Shane Lyons reporting “Faiyum is in good nick and is as fit as we can get her without a run. All our horses are only ready to start.

"She won't mind the ground, she was very impressive in Gowran and is a good filly. We are looking forward to her this season."
